BODYWORK
PROTECTION FROM ATMOSPHERIC
AGENTS
The main causes of corrosion are:
❒atmospheric pollution;
❒salty air and humidity (coastal areas, or hot humid
climates);
❒seasonal environment conditions.
In addition, the abrasiveness of dust in the atmosphere
and sand carried by the wind as well as mud and
stones kicked up by other cars must not be
underestimated.
On your Fiat Multipla, Fiat implemented the best
manufacturing technologies to effectively protect the
bodywork against corrosion.These include:
❒painting products and systems which give the car
particular resistance to corrosion and abrasion;
❒use of galvanised (or pre-treated) steel sheets, with
high resistance to corrosion;
❒spraying the underbody, engine compartment,
wheelhouse internal parts and other parts with
highly protective wax products;
❒spraying of plastic parts, with a protective function,
in the most exposed points: underdoor, inner
fender parts, edges, etc.
❒use of “open” boxed sections to prevent
condensation and pockets of moisture from
triggering rust inside.
BODY AND UNDERBODY
WARRANTY
Your Fiat Multipla is covered by warranty against
perforation due to rust of any original element of the
structure or body.
For the general terms of this warranty, refer to Fiat
Warranty Booklet.

STEERING WHEEL / GEAR LEVER KNOB
WITH GENUINE LEATHER COVERING
These components shall only be cleaned with water
and neutral soap.
Never use spirit or alcohol-based products.
Before using special products for cleaning interiors,
read carefully label instructions and indications to
make sure they are free from spirit and/or alcohol-
based substances.If when cleaning the windscreen with special glass
products, some drops fall on the leather covering of
the steering wheel/gear lever knob remove them
immediately and then clean with water and neutral
soap.
IMPORTANT Take the utmost care when engaging
the steering lock to prevent scratching the leather
covering.
Never use inflammable products like fuel oil ether or rectified petrol for cleaning
inside the car. The electrostatic discharges generated when rubbing to clean may
cause fire.WARNING
Do not keep aerosol cans in the car. They might explode. Aerosol cans must never
be exposed to a temperature above 50°C. The temperature inside the car exposed
to the sun may go well beyond that figure. WARNING

BRAKES
10016V - JTD 120
Service brakes:
– front Disc, self-ventilating
– rear Drum, self-centring shoes with mechanism for backlash recovery.
Disc on cars fitted with ESP (optional).
Handbrake Controlled by a lever, it works on the rear brakes
IMPORTANT Water, ice and antifreeze salt on roads may deposit on the brake discs thus reducing braking efficiency
at first braking.
SUSPENSIONS
10016V - JTD 120
Front Mc Pherson independent wheels.
Rear Independent wheels.
STEERING
100 16V- JTD 120
Type Rack and pinion with power steering.
Minimum steering cycle m 11

WHEELS
RIMS AND TYRES
Pressed steel or alloy rims (where provided). Tubeless
tyres with radial carcass.
All homologated tyres are listed in the log book.
IMPORTANT In the event of discrepancies between
the information provided on this OWNER
HANDBOOK and the LOG BOOK, consider the
specifications shown in the log book only.
Attaining to the prescribed size, to ensure safety of
the car in movement, it must be fitted with tyres of
the same make and type on all wheels.
IMPORTANT Do not use inner tubes with Tubeless
tyres.
WHEEL GEOMETRY
Front wheel toe-in measured from rim to rim: –3 ±1
mm.
SPACE-SAVER SPARE WHEEL
Pressed steel rim. Tubeless tyre.SNOW TYRES
Use the snow tyres specified in section “Driving your
car” in paragraph “Snow tyres”.
SNOW CHAINS
Only use low profile chains, see section “Driving your
car” in paragraph “Snow chains”.
UNDERSTANDING TYRE MARKING
Example: 185/65 R15 88H
185 = Nominal width (distance between sidewalls
in mm).
65 = Height/width ratio (as a percentage).
R = Radial tyre.
15 = Rim diameter in inches.
88 = Load rating.
H = Maximum speed rating.

UNDERSTANDING RIM MARKING
The following are the necessary indications to understand the meaning of
the markings on the rim, as shown in the figure.
Example: 6 J x 15 H2
6 = rim width in inches (1)
J = rim drop center outline (side projection where the tyre bead rests)
(2)
15 = rim nominal diameter in inches (corresponds to diameter of the
tyre to be mounted) (3 =Ø)
H2 = “hump“ shape and number (relief on the circumference holding the
TUBELESS tyre bead on the rim)

COLD TYRE INFLATION PRESSURE (bar)
Add +0.3 bar to the prescribed inflation pressure when the tyres are warm. Recheck pressure value with cold tyres.
With snow tyres, add +0.2 bar to the inflation pressure value prescribed for standard tyres.
